site stats

Traverse a tree java

WebMay 15, 2011 · @jbuddy_13 Typically one would traverse the tree for a reason (e.g. printing the value of the node's content). process handles that. – BiGYaN. May 8, 2024 at 4:37. … WebJan 15, 2014 · Websearch "depth first tree walk" and/or "breadth first tree walk". The former is more common, but there are applications for the latter. If the tree nodes are doubly …

Trees in Java Java Program to Implement a Binary Tree Edureka

WebOct 21, 2024 · 1. Traverse the left sub-tree (keep visit the left sub tree until you reach leaf node). 2. Visit the current node. 3. Traverse the left sub-tree. (same as #1) //pay attention to visit and traverse. The In order binary tree traversal will give the output in … WebApr 13, 2024 · A binary tree is a data structure consisting of nodes, where each node has at most two children. Traversal refers to the process of visiting each node in the tree … town of rosemary beach florida https://royalsoftpakistan.com

Binary Tree Implementation in Java - Insertion, Traversal And …

WebMar 15, 2012 · I'm trying to traverse a tree using ANTLR tree commands and recursion. The code I currently have is: public void traverseTree(Tree tree){ int counter = 0; … WebApr 12, 2012 · 1. The traverse method is for using the elements in your binary tree but you're returning the root left, root right or root (even if root is null !). The idea to recursive … WebAug 26, 2024 · The easiest way to implement the preOrder traversal of a binary tree in Java is by using recursion. The recursive solution is hardly 3 to 4 lines of code and exactly mimic the steps, but before that, let's … town of roslyn ny

Tree Traversal - javatpoint

Category:Java Program to Perform the preorder tree traversal

Tags:Traverse a tree java

Traverse a tree java

Trees in Java Java Program to Implement a Binary Tree Edureka

WebMay 27, 2024 · There are four ways to traverse a tree. These four processes fall into one of two categories: breadth-first traversal or depth-first traversal. Inorder: Think of this as … WebThe above C code hives the following output. Select one of the operations:: 1. To insert a new node in the Binary Tree 2. To display the nodes of the Binary Tree (via Inorder Traversal). 1 Enter the value to be inserted 12 Do you want to continue (Type y or n) y Select one of the operations:: 1.

Traverse a tree java

Did you know?

WebMay 28, 2024 · Here is a complete binary search tree implementation program in Java with methods for inserting a node in BST, traversing binary search tree in preorder, posrtorder and inorder, search a node in binary search tree. public class BinaryTree { // first node private Node root; BinaryTree() { root = null; } // Class representing tree nodes static ...

WebHere's how it can be defined: First rule: The first node in the tree is the leftmost node in the tree. Next rule: The successor of a node is: Next-R rule: If it has a right subtree, the … WebDec 6, 2012 · 1. I think the answer is inheritance. Make a class called tree node for all types of nodes. This will work as a super class. For all the actual types such as apple, grass or …

WebTree Traversal. It is a technique similar to graph traversal. In this process, each node is visited in a tree data structure. It consists of two techniques for traversing: Depth First Traversal. In-order. Pre-order. Post-order. Breadth First Traversal. WebTree traversal (Inorder, Preorder an Postorder) In this article, we will discuss the tree traversal in the data structure. The term 'tree traversal' means traversing or visiting …

WebInorder Tree Traversal. Output. In Order traversal 5->12->6->1->9-> In the above example, we have implemented the tree data structure in Java. Here, we are performing the …

WebFYI, EntrySet is the preferred way to iterate through any Map since EntrySets are by specification reflective and always represent the state of data in the Map even if the Map … town of rothesay zoning mapWeb1. Traverse the left subtree and display the node. 2. Display the parent node of the left subtree. 3. Traverse the right subtree and display the node. From the example, you can see that as the given tree is a binary tree the nodes are printed in sorted order. Hope you’ve understood the code. town of ross recreation departmentWebOct 21, 2024 · 1. Traverse the left sub-tree (keep visit the left sub tree until you reach leaf node). 2. Visit the current node. 3. Traverse the left sub-tree. (same as #1) //pay … town of roslyn waWebDefinition. In Java, the vertical order traversal of a binary tree is a traversal algorithm that outputs the nodes in the vertical order of a binary tree. In this traversal, nodes at the same horizontal distance from the root node are clustered together and output their depth in ascending order. The vertical distance is defined as the distance ... town of rothesay logoWebDec 7, 2024 · This method returns a collection-view (Set) of the mappings contained in this treemap. So we can iterate over key-value pair using getKey () and … town of rosthern skWebMay 27, 2024 · There are four ways to traverse a tree. These four processes fall into one of two categories: breadth-first traversal or depth-first traversal. Inorder: Think of this as moving up the tree, then back down. You traverse the left child and its sub-tree until you reach the root. Then, traverse down the right child and its subtree. town of rotterdamWebTraversing a tree means visiting every node in the tree. You might, for instance, want to add all the values in the tree or find the largest one. For all these operations, you will … town of rothesay jobs